Saintsbury Winery, established in 1981 by Richard Ward and David Graves, is located in Napa Valley and remains family-owned. Both founders met during their Enology studies at UC Davis and shared a passion for Burgundian wines. Before launching their winery, they gained experience at various Napa Valley wineries. Initially, they produced wine at Pine Ridge Winery and later built their own facility on previously grazing land. Saintsbury focuses primarily on Pinot Noir and Chardonnay, producing around 10,000 cases annually, down from a peak of over 60,000 cases. The winery is known for its approachable and personalized tasting experiences, set in a casual environment without elaborate décor. Visitors can enjoy tastings outdoors under trees or in a simple tasting room. The winery is named after George Saintsbury, a notable English professor and wine writer. Saintsbury offers a range of wines, including unique varietals like Mencía and a pétillant naturel. Their commitment to quality is evident in their vineyard practices and the careful selection of grapes sourced from Carneros and other regions.
